    Will your desert rose rot out in the open like that if it gets too much rain? I've heard that could happen. Mine is under the overhang of my front porch. I'm not sure that is the best place for it. What do you think? They're a gift from my sister in law, I don't want to kill them. Thanks. Your new area looks amazing. Thanks for sharing.

  • @WildFloridian

    @WildFloridian

    4 ай бұрын

    I would like to caveat that I'm not a desert rose expert. BUT that desert rose has been without cover for AT LEAST 10 years. It has never shown signs of rot and only slowed its blooms due to lack of sun last year. The previous owners left it behind when they moved out. Ben and I just repotted it in that huge pot.... maybe 6 years ago. I also have neighbors who have desert roses and they aren't under cover. BUT they are all large plants. So it might be different when they are small. I hope my anecdotal advice helps. best wishes with your lovely gift! :D
